Best Areas to Book an Airbnb in Istanbul

Istanbul is a vast and diverse city, and choosing the right neighborhood is crucial for an enjoyable stay. Whether you’re seeking vibrant nightlife, historic landmarks, or local authenticity, there’s a perfect fit for every traveler.

Taksim and Beyoğlu

taksim istanbul turkeyTaksim and Beyoğlu are among the most sought-after locations for visitors, offering a central location with vibrant energy. With numerous listings for Airbnb Turkey Istanbul Taksim, you’ll find:

  • Easy access to Istiklal Street, Galata Tower, and nightlife
  • Plenty of cafes, restaurants, and shops
  • A mix of modern and historic architecture
  • Great transportation links via metro and bus

Ideal for: First-time visitors, couples, and those who want to be in the heart of the action.

Sultanahmet and Old City

Sultanahmet Istambul TurkeyThis is Istanbul’s historical core, where centuries of history come alive. Booking here means staying just steps from:

  • Hagia Sophia, the Blue Mosque, and Topkapi Palace
  • Traditional architecture and cobblestone streets
  • Classic Turkish guesthouses and apartment rentals in Istanbul

Ideal for: History lovers, cultural explorers, and photography enthusiasts.

Beşiktaş and Şişli

Beşiktaş Istanbul TurkeyThese neighborhoods offer a balanced mix of local life and urban convenience, making them great for more extended stays and digital nomads.

  • Home to embassies, shopping malls, and trendy bars
  • Excellent transportation hubs
  • Home to some of the best Istanbul vacation rentals for long-term stays

Ideal for: Professionals, long-term travelers, and families.

Kadıköy and Moda

Kadıköy Istanbul TurkeyOn the Asian side of the city, Kadıköy and Moda provide a more relaxed, local vibe with artsy and bohemian touches.

  • Weekly markets, vintage shops, and seaside walks
  • Excellent food scene and coffee culture
  • Frequent ferries to the European side

Ideal for: Digital nomads, returning visitors, and those wanting a local lifestyle.

Galata and Karaköy

Galata Istanbul TurkeyHistoric yet modern, these areas bridge the old and new, offering charm and contemporary style.

  • Close proximity to the Galata Tower and Karaköy Port
  • Galleries, boutique shops, and chic cafes
  • A hotspot for unique apartments and vacation rentals

Ideal for: Young travelers, artists, and architecture fans.

Airbnb Istanbul, Turkey Long Term Rentals

For travelers planning to stay more than a few weeks, Airbnb Istanbul, Turkey, offers long-term rentals that are convenient, cost-effective, and flexible.

Benefits of monthly stays

Choosing a long-term Airbnb rental in Istanbul comes with several advantages:

  • Discounted Rates: Most listings offer significant discounts—often 20–40%—for monthly bookings.
  • Fully Furnished: Apartments typically include all essentials such as furniture, kitchenware, linens, and appliances.
  • No Long-Term Commitment: Ideal for visitors who want flexibility without signing a lease.
  • Utilities Included: Many hosts bundle Wi-Fi, electricity, and water into the total cost, simplifying budgeting.

Ideal neighborhoods for long-term visitors or digital nomads

Certain districts in Istanbul are particularly well-suited for extended stays:

  • Beşiktaş & Şişli: Central, well-connected, and filled with amenities like coworking spaces, gyms, and cafes.
  • Kadıköy: On the Asian side, this bohemian neighborhood offers a local vibe, lower costs, and easy European ferry access.
  • Cihangir & Galata: Trendy areas popular among creatives and remote workers due to their charm and walkability.
  • Atasehir & Üsküdar: Quiet residential zones with newer apartment complexes and family-friendly environments.

Rental Cost Breakdown

Average pricing per night

Prices for Airbnb Istanbul apartments vary depending on location, amenities, and time of year:

  • Budget Apartments: Starting around $40–$60 per night.
  • Mid-Range Rentals: Typically range between $70–$120 per night.
  • Luxury Stays: Can exceed $200 per night, especially in prime areas or for listings with sea views and premium amenities.

Weekly and monthly bookings often come with discounts, especially if you’re seeking a long-term Airbnb stay in Istanbul, Turkey.

Average pricing for long-term stays

Before booking a long-term Airbnb Istanbul, Turkey stay, consider the following:

Monthly Costs:

  • Budget rentals: $700–$1,000/month
  • Mid-range: $1,000–$1,800/month
  • Luxury apartments: $2,000–$3,500+/month

Quick Stats About Airbnb in Istanbul

Understanding the current landscape of Airbnb rentals in Istanbul can help travelers make informed decisions. Here’s an overview of key statistics:

Number of listings citywide

According to recent data, Istanbul has approximately 36,096 active Airbnb listings, which represents a 3% increase over the past year.

Most popular times to book

The peak booking periods for Airbnb rentals in Istanbul are during spring (April to June) and autumn (September to mid-November). These seasons offer mild weather and coincide with events like the Tulip Festival and the Istanbul Biennial.

Typical guest profiles

Istanbul attracts a diverse range of Airbnb guests, including:

  • Solo Travelers and Couples: Often seeking short-term stays in central neighborhoods.
  • Families: Looking for spacious accommodations near major attractions.
  • Digital Nomads and Remote Workers: Preferring properties with dedicated workspaces and reliable internet.

Frequently Asked Questions About Airbnb in Istanbul

Is Airbnb allowed in Istanbul?

Yes, Airbnb is legal in Istanbul. Hosts must comply with local regulations, including obtaining a short-term rental permit and approval from the building’s residents.

Is it safe to book an Airbnb in Istanbul, Turkey?

Yes, especially when booking verified listings with positive reviews and communicating directly through the Airbnb platform.

Do Airbnb hosts in Istanbul speak English?

Many do, particularly in tourist-heavy areas. Listings usually mention language capabilities—reach out to confirm.

Are there luxury Airbnb apartments available in Istanbul?

Absolutely. Luxury Airbnb Istanbul Turkey listings feature amenities like sea views, jacuzzis, rooftop terraces, and designer interiors.

What amenities should I expect from a luxury Airbnb in Istanbul?

High-end kitchens, concierge service, Wi-Fi, air conditioning, laundry, smart TVs, and sometimes private pools.

How do Airbnb prices in Istanbul compare to hotels?

Airbnb often provides more space and amenities for less than the cost of 4–5 star hotels, especially for families or long stays.

Are there Airbnbs in Istanbul suitable for remote work or digital nomads?

Yes, many include fast Wi-Fi and a dedicated workspace in İstanbul. Some even cater specifically to digital nomads.

Are family-friendly Airbnb apartments available in Istanbul?

Yes, many listings offer multiple bedrooms, cribs, high chairs, and laundry—ideal for families.

Are pet-friendly Airbnb rentals common in Istanbul, Turkey?

Yes. Use the “pet-friendly” filter on Airbnb to find listings that welcome pets.

Do Airbnb's in Istanbul offer airport pickup services?

Some do. Look for listings that mention “airport transfer” or ask your host directly.

What is the best time of year to rent an Airbnb in Istanbul?

Spring (April–June) and fall (September–November) offer the best weather and fewer crowds.

How early should I book an Airbnb in Istanbul during peak season?

At least 2–3 months in advance is recommended, especially from April to August.

What’s the cancellation policy for most Airbnbs in Istanbul?

It varies by host—be sure to read the listing’s policy. Many offer flexible or moderate cancellation terms.
